Bring Your Ideas To Execution With Our MVP for Start-ups

A Minimum Viable Product (MVP) is a development technique used to quickly validate an idea or product hypothesis by creating a basic version with the core features. MVP is a crucial step for start-ups to validate their business idea before investing in a full-fledged product. It allows start-ups to test their product in the market and gather valuable feedback from users. This feedback can then be used to make improvements and refine the product. An MVP is a basic version of the product that contains only the essential features needed to satisfy early adopters and test the market demand. While building an MVP, start-ups face many challenges, including selecting the right technology stack, managing the development process, and ensuring scalability. Purpose The purpose of an MVP is to validate a product hypothesis with minimum resources and time. Instead of investing significant amounts of time and money in building a fully featured product, start-ups can create a basic version with only the core features. The MVP can then be tested in the market to gather feedback from users and understand whether there is a market need for the product. This feedback can be used to refine the product and make it more appealing to users. Why is it critical An MVP is critical for start-ups because it helps them reduce the risk of building a product that does not have a market need. Instead of investing a lot of time and resources into building a fully featured product, start-ups can create an MVP to test their product hypothesis. By testing the MVP in the market and gathering feedback from users, start-ups can ensure that they are building a product that meets the needs of their target audience.

Step-by-step approach on building MVP using the best practices

The first step in building an MVP is to identify the problem that you want to solve. Talk to your potential customers, understand their pain points, and find out how you can help them.

Once you have identified the problem, it’s time to define the scope of your MVP. Determine the minimum set of features that your MVP should have to solve the problem

Choose the right technologies that can help you build your MVP quickly and efficiently. Consider factors such as scalability, flexibility, and cost-effectiveness.

Develop a prototype of your MVP using wireframes or mock-ups. This will help you validate your idea and get feedback from your potential customers.

Once you have a validated prototype, it’s time to start developing your MVP. Use agile development methodologies such as Scrum to develop your MVP quickly and iteratively.

Test and validate your MVP with your potential customers. Collect feedback, measure user engagement, and use data to iterate and improve your MVP.

Once you have a validated MVP, it’s time to launch it to the market. However, launching your MVP is just the beginning. Use the feedback and data you collect to iterate and improve your MVP continuously

Once you have a successful MVP, it’s time to scale your product. Use your MVP as a foundation and build on top of it to create a scalable and sustainable product. It’s important to remember that building an MVP is a continuous process that requires constant learning, iteration, and improvement.
